Output 26642db808d76b448afc55c686044f7f6ef1adf96ae56ab8a665702ef949f5fe:7

value
128488
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e296ec4db88c813e87139e24f79f964dbdd90e6acfd2db182a670fcf36f7d7d
address
bc1plc5ka3xm3ryp86r3883y770evndamy8x4n7jmvvz5ec0eum0047stdxrka
transaction
26642db808d76b448afc55c686044f7f6ef1adf96ae56ab8a665702ef949f5fe
spent
true